The only problem is that the story talkes about Kirlokowsky and the Seattle Police Department, a small drop in the bucket. Now if it was Dave Reichert and the King County Police Department who was in this story, I'd be a bit more optimistic. Reason I say this is Seattle, though a major city, is one of many cities that are in the King County jurisdiction. What needs to happen is that the King County police department, Snohomish police department, and the Pierce county police department need to start talking with one another. This would then pretty much cover the whole Western Washington area from Mount Vernon all the way down to Ft. Lewis.

its prolly lojack
http://www.lojack.com
when u report ur car stolen the cops can home in on a beacon that ur car emits... they way theives are getting around that is they steal the car then let it sit in a parking lot or somewhere and see if the cops pick it up or not
they even have a bounty hunter in mexico i heard so if u live in SD or anywher near the border it would be something to look into

NO
**** LOJACK
i personally know / have met 2 guys whose type r's have been stolen and never recovered with lo jack.......... one in san fran, one in PA
and to put that into perspective, i've only met 8 type r owners total from the US (we don't have lojack in canada).... so that's 25% of the people i've met in the states with type r's and lo jack have had their cars stolen and never recovered. HA HA HA.
i ain't trustin' that.
anyways, go to http://www.directed.com and under viper or clifford alarms check out the responder/ gps.... another alternative. integrates really well with a DEI alarm system and you can monitor your car by phone and online yourself too...
boomerang's the next one, it enjoys pretty good success in canada and has been introduced in california as well.
